What is the latest Android version for Note Edge?
Android 6.0.1
Samsung Galaxy Note Edge
| Galaxy Note Edge, showing its curved bezel. | |
|---|---|
| Mass | International & Korea Variant : 174 g Japan Variant : 177 g |
| Operating system | Original: Android 4.4.4 “KitKat” First major update: Android 5.0.1 “Lollipop” Second major update: Android 5.1.1 “Lollipop” Current: Android 6.0.1 “Marshmallow” |
How do I update my Galaxy Note Edge?
It is recommended to back up your phone before you start this guide.
- Select Apps.
- Select Settings.
- Select System.
- Scroll to and select About device.
- Select Software updates.
- Select Update now.
- Wait for the search to finish.
- If your phone is up to date, select OK.

Does Galaxy Note Edge support 4G?
Connectivity options on the Samsung Galaxy Note Edge include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ac, GPS, Bluetooth v4. 10, NFC, Infrared, Mobile High-Definition Link (MHL), 3G, and 4G.

How do I upgrade EDGE to LTE?
Switch between 3G/4G – Samsung Galaxy Note Edge
- Select Apps.
- Select Settings.
- Select More networks.
- Select Mobile networks.
- Select Network mode.
- Select WCDMA/GSM (auto connect) to enable 3G and LTE/WCDMA/GSM (auto connect) to enable 4G.
